Output 13e3265720343b5963db210f98cfa22d8661a728be3d0947e0951bf8b6eb19f9:19

value
33400563
script pubkey
OP_0 OP_PUSHBYTES_20 c23e5b4155495fe076ea1062de57588d12d01b9c
address
bc1qcgl9ks24f907qah2zp3du46c35fdqxuut9p2dh
transaction
13e3265720343b5963db210f98cfa22d8661a728be3d0947e0951bf8b6eb19f9
spent
true